supersensually

[soo-per-sen-shoo-uh-lee]

supersensually Definition

in a manner that is beyond the normal range of perception or sensation.

Summary: supersensually in Brief

The adverb 'supersensually' [soo-per-sen-shoo-uh-lee] describes something that is beyond the normal range of perception or sensation. It is often used to describe experiences that are heightened or intensified, such as in the sentence 'The artist's work was meant to be experienced supersensually.'
